Anyway I first attempted a half moon manicure. It looked totally cute and simple. After checking out a couple videos on youtube I became convinced it would be a piece of cake.



I used Color Club Revvolution and China Glaze LOL


How it Should Have Looked (From Marie Claire Magazine)

Yeah idk I used french tip guides on the base and I guess I should have put them higher or angled or something, cause it just looks like I didn't polish all the way down and there is no moon action going on. PlasmaSpeedo on youtube used Hole Reinforcements as the guide so maybe that would help get a more rounded moon and not a straight line like I did.
